    Biggest issue they've had is putting together the boring back end stuff like 64bit world map support for cryengine, zone instancing for vehicles/space stations (to allow gravity switching as you enter leave craft and also large multi crew craft to operate with lots of small fighters on the same map without killing the netcode) and new netcode (they ditched the cryengine code as it just couldn't cope). Hopefully now these have been demonstrated in the recent demo it should just be a case of bug fixing and stitching together. The next 6 months should be quite productive (Even more so from the single player perspective as that has been progressing in the background by a separate team).

    Really, $90M is not chicken feed. Assume a developer costs you $100K per year to hire including cost of office space and equipment (game devs aren't that well paid so it seems a fair guess). That would mean 900 man years of effort for the money. That really is a lot, partly because development doesn't scale that well: you can't make a baby in one month by getting 9 women pregnant and software often works the same way. The way out of that is to create some sort of playable game ASAP, and grow the rest around it.

    So in the long run I wouldn't be surprised if Elite ends up the bigger game simply because they have better execution and a proper revenue model of selling a product.

    I would love to be wrong, but SC just seems to be a Daikatana for the 21st century, all vision and no progress. At some point I expect panic to set in and something to ship that fails to meet expectations, and the longer the delay the bigger those expectations will be.
